On Monday, 2 May 2016 at 08:09:47 UTC, Lodovico Giaretta wrote:
> Hi,
>
> I think this code should work, but the compiler does not agree.
> Am I missing something?
>
> void main()
> {
> alias funType = void function(int x);
> funType fun = (x) => { assert(x); }; // cannot return
> non-void from void function
> fun(0);
> }
>
> From the language reference I understand that assert shoud
> return void, so I can't see how this code is wrong.
Wrong syntax!
You mean (x) { assert(x); }
or
(x) => assert(x)
